Ready or not – school starts Tuesday, and your kiddos are already gearing up in a big way! The Parish Universe has been abuzz with activity all week. Here’s a quick rundown of what’s been goin’ on. Enjoy…
Today, the Midway Campus is an AWESOME place to be. All 3rd-12th graders are here for orientation. 3rd graders went on a scavenger hunt to help them get used to their new digs. Middle Schoolers piled into the Chapel to come together as a group before they got down to business, and the Upper School was treated to a big ol’ ice cream sundae, so we captured them taking a scoop for The Scoop (Get it? We know… ha, ha, ha!)
Our athletes have been super busy for the past three weeks getting in shape and in sync for the upcoming cross country, football and volleyball season. Can you say 1.5-hour evening practices, 2-a-days and preseason tournaments? Panthers are certainly puttin’ in the time, so let’s all get out and support their dedication as the sports seasons kick off.
Parent volunteers were the main attraction on Wednesday as our community turned out in droves to get all things Parish-related at Back-to-School day. Thank you to all of you who were involved in this magnificent undertaking. You are invaluable in making sure we all start off on the right foot.
Our little bitty ones have been treated to home visits by their classroom teachers this week. It’s a Parish tradition for all pre-k and kindergarten students and new students in 1st-4th grades to get this special time with their teachers. What a wonderful way to welcome new families into this community! Let’s all follow suit, and take the time to make them feel at home as well.
